Role Description

As an Account Director of Revenue Lifecycle Management, you are a key member of Neocol's leadership team and a commercial and delivery owner for a growing portfolio of subscription-economy clients. You own the health, growth, and satisfaction of your accounts end to end-from identifying expansion opportunities and shaping new statements of work to serving as a senior billable resource on the engagements themselves.

In this role you operate as both a trusted client advisor and a hands-on Engagement Manager, carrying a billable quota while helping direct the practice in partnership with other leaders. You bring deep expertise in Salesforce Revenue Cloud delivery, consultative account growth, and executive stakeholder management, and you thrive in a fast-paced, evolving environment where you can turn complex client goals into repeatable, profitable outcomes.

This role reports to the SVP of Delivery and is critical to the success of Neocol's consulting practice. Travel is primarily client-facing and may range from 10-25%.
